Poem: Mah-e-Nau
Book: Bang-e-Dra 24
By
Dr. Allama Muhammad Iqbal
The new moon is the stage that is undetectable to us here on Earth in light of the fact that the moon is between the earth and the sun, and its enlightened side is confronting far from us. The new moon denotes the start of the lunar cycle, the development of the moon through its diverse stages, Allama Muhammad Iqbal has written this short poem with great beauty.
